The 2025 MLK Hunger Bowl at New Mount Rose Missionary Baptist Church



Fort Worth, Texas – New Mount Rose Missionary Baptist Church, in collaboration with partners Midwest Food Bank, Secured Moving Company, the Sheriff’s Department Detail, and the Ministers Justice Coalition, is proud to host the 2025 MLK Hunger Bowl on Thursday, January 9, 2025, at 3:00 PM. This event is part of the 2025 MLK End Hunger Challenge, aimed at addressing the hunger crisis in Fort Worth’s 76104 ZIP code, which has the lowest life expectancy in Texas.


Since its founding in 1964, New Mount Rose has been a cornerstone of support in the Fort Worth community, providing spiritual nourishment and essential resources to those in need. Whether offering physical food or spiritual care, New Mount Rose continues to “fill our neighbors’ bowls with blessings for their souls.”


The MLK Hunger Bowl at New Mount Rose is a pivotal event in the ongoing fight against hunger, a reflection of the core values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. advocated for throughout his life—selflessness, service, and community unity. This year’s Hunger Bowl will provide food, prayer, and a sense of hope to over 500 families in underserved areas of Fort Worth.


“We are grateful for the opportunity to continue Dr. King’s legacy of service, particularly in our 76104 community,” said Pastor Kyev P. Tatum. “This event is not only about feeding the body but also nourishing the spirit. Our aim is to address the food insecurity that so many of our neighbors face and ensure they feel the support and love of this community.”


The MLK Hunger Bowl will feature:

Free food distribution for families, including canned goods, fresh produce, bread, milk, pastries, and more.

Community prayers to uplift and encourage those in need.

Information on resources and support for individuals facing food insecurity and other challenges.
